Abstract

In nature, bipedal locomotion systems show high abilities at avoiding obstacles and tracking complex trajectories. Humanoids robotics proposes a panel of solutions to carry on locomotion intelligent control. In this paper, we present a hybrid intelligent architecture for a humanoid robot control, 'IZiman". A particle swarm based control is proposed to generate the joints trajectories for a human like walking strategy.
